Binotto claims Ferrari 'misjudged the weaknesses and limitations of our package'

Ferrari has been nowhere near Mercedes during the 2019 Formula 1 season. They seem to have gone backwards since pre-season and Mattia Binotto tries to explain why. The Italian team dominated the pre-season tests, and you could blame this on the Mercedes sandbags. However, during the Barcelona Grand Prix, Ferrari couldn't find their pre-season form with a delta of eight-tenths of a second. "For a straightforward comparison in Barcelona between test and race, we have done worse for one simple reason. We developed the car in the wrong direction.
